RICHMOND, Va. (AP) — The University of Richmond has named Hanover County Schools Superintendent Jamelle Wilson as dean of the School of Professional and Continuing Studies.

Wilson's appointment is effective Aug. 1. She will replace Jim Narduzzi, who had served as dean for 21 years.

The university announced Wilson's appointment on Wednesday in a news release.

She has been superintendent of Hanover County Public Schools since July 11 and has served the district for more than 20 years.
